Summer Computing Camps Expand to the Caribbean
For the first time since it launched a decade ago, the College's summer computing camp program is reaching students outside of the continental U.S. Through a budding partnership with the University of the Virgin Islands,
the College is bringing computing camps to students in Saint Thomas and Saint Croix in the U.S. Virgin Islands
.
